| Slashed | imp. & p. p. | of Slash |
| Slashed | a. | Marked or cut with a slash or slashes; deeply gashed; especially, having long, narrow openings, as a sleeve or other part of a garment, to show rich lining or under vesture. |
| Slashed | a. | Divided into many narrow parts or segments by sharp incisions; laciniate. |
